Drawbacks of Conventional Job Portals


Historically, organisations have relied on a free job posting portal for companies or premium job boards to reach applicants. Although these platforms provide exposure, they frequently generate an excessive volume of applications, a significant portion of which are unsuitable to the role. This requires recruiters to spend valuable time reviewing CVs, ultimately reducing hiring efficiency.

Another drawback is the expense linked to conventional hiring can quickly add up. Subscription fees, premium listings, and additional recruitment tools increase the overall cost per hire. Smaller and scaling organisations, this can be hard to sustain, hindering smooth hiring processes. Even the leading hiring platforms for businesses often struggle to provide applicants who fit organisational culture or long-term objectives.

A further key concern is the lack of pre-screening. Individuals applying via job portals generally do not have any prior association with the employer, so their fit is not assessed beyond CV details. This leads to mismatches, delayed hiring processes, and higher employee turnover rates.

Advantages of Referral Hiring


A primary benefits of referral hiring for companies is improved candidate quality. Candidates referred by trusted contacts, there is an built-in trust factor. This typically leads to candidates who are well-suited, relevant, and likely to perform.

Additionally, referral hiring accelerates recruitment. Because applicants are pre-qualified, recruiters can advance candidates rapidly through the process. This speed is especially valuable in fast-paced sectors where top talent is quickly hired.

Another key benefit is improved retention. Referred hires often remain longer and perform strongly. They enter with better clarity about workplace culture, reducing the likelihood of early attrition.

In addition, referral hiring supports stronger team dynamics. When team members suggest hires, they are more committed to their success. This encourages teamwork and strengthens workplace relationships.

Steps to Start Referral Hiring


Moving to a referral hiring system does not demand major changes of existing processes. Companies can begin by adding referral programmes to existing hiring processes.

Promoting internal referrals is a simple yet effective step. Employee networks frequently contain qualified individuals who may not seek roles publicly. Leveraging these networks can significantly improve hiring outcomes.

Organisations can also use a free job posting platform for businesses that enables referral hiring to measure impact. By comparing results with traditional methods, recruiters can see advantages more clearly.

Using screening systems confirms candidate suitability before advancing further. This boosts effectiveness and minimises manual tasks.

Tracking key metrics such as time-to-hire and cost-per-hire helps organisations measure the success of referral hiring. These insights enable continuous optimisation and better decision-making.
